35 Affordable Waterfront Retirement Towns (2, #1)

UPDATED September, 2021, plus seven bonus towns added!   Want to retire near the water?   Doing so is a lifelong dream for many people. So when retirement time arrives, moving to a lakeside town, riverfront hamlet or seaside community is a natural inclination. The trick is to find a place to retire near the water that is reasonably priced.  

Here we have 35 towns (plus seven bonus towns) that sit next to a lake, have a lake within their boundaries or are along a river or a seacoast.   They have a cost of living that meets the national average or is below the national average, as primarily determined by housing prices.  

We also look at population, climate, home prices, percentage of residents age 45 or better, medical facilities, public transportation, crime rates, political leanings and more.  No place is perfect, however, so we point out each town's potential drawbacks.   Reviews are short and to the point for quick reading.
